About the Role

MediaMonks is looking to a Senior Creative to add to the global superband of creatives. In this role, youll provide our clients with creative decks, ideas and direction, bringing forth award-winning products and web campaigns for one of the world's leading tech brands.

We are looking for a conceptual thinker and creative leader who is native to the worlds of both digital web and artificial intelligence. You are a storyteller, a technologist, and a taste-maker who understands that a great prompt can be as powerful as a great headline.

As a Creative Director at Monks, you will be the driving force behind our creative output, translating our clients' complex technologies into compelling, human?centric stories. You will lead teams of designers, writers, and other designers, guiding them to create work that is not only beautiful and effective but also genuinely innovative. You are both a visionary who can imagine the future of brand expression and a hands?on leader who can guide a team to bring that vision to life, pixel by pixel, prompt by prompt.

About Monks

Monks is the global, purely digital, unitary operating brand of S4Capital plc. With a legacy of innovation and specialized expertise, Monks combines an extraordinary range of global marketing and technology services to accelerate business possibilities and redefine how brands and businesses interact with the world. Its integration of systems and workflows delivers unfettered content production, scaled experiences, enterprise?grade technology and data science fueled by AImanaged by the industrys best and most diverse digital talentto help the worlds trailblazing companies outmaneuver and outpace their competition.

Monks was named a Contender in The Forrester Wave: Global Marketing Services. It has remained a constant presence on Adweeks Fastest Growing lists (2019-23), ranks among Cannes Lions' Top 10 Creative Companies (2022-23) and is the only partner to have been placed in AdExchangers Programmatic Power Players list every year (2020-24). In addition to being named Adweeks first AI Agency of the Year (2023), Monks has been recognized by Business Intelligence in its 2024 Excellence in Artificial Intelligence Awards program in three categories: the Individual category, Organizational Winner in AI Strategic Planning and AI Product for its service Monks.Flow. Monks has also garnered the title of Webby Production Company of the Year (2021-24), won a record number of FWAs and has earned a spot on Newsweeks Top 100 Global Most Loved Workplaces 2023.
